Contexto is a daily word guessing game where you try to find a secret word based on semantic similarity. Unlike Wordle, Contexto doesn't limit your guesses. Each guess is ranked by how close it is in meaning to the target word using AI.

Tips to Solve Contexto Faster Start with broad, common nouns and observe the rank numbers carefully. Words ranked under 500 are very close - pivot your guesses around those. Think in categories: if "ocean" is close, try other water related words. Synonyms and related concepts are your best tool. Avoid verbs and adjectives early; the answer is almost always a noun.
